The first picture is from when I first walked up on this debris in my back yard. The second picture is one when I brought it pieces inside to get a picture of what is actually was. Turns out it is paneling that goes on a interior wall.

The channel five news (WRAL News) here in eastern nc was tracking a tornado coming through wilson headed towards Elm City and finally moving near Rocky Mount. The best the family and I can figure is the tornado picked it up from a destroyed house/trailor and carried it inside the tornado/storm then dropped it down in our yard.

These storms came through and almost every storm cell had the signature hook in it indicating rotation on radar. Wilson, NC and Sanford, NC had a bit more damage with tornados moving through each city while flipping cars and leveling a few houses.

Its amazing how strong the forces of nature are.
